interference with
干扰(某人/某事)
频率: 8.619.4 每百万词
Used to indicate the person, thing, or process that is being interfered with (e.g., with medical procedures, with justice).
用于指明被干涉的人、事物或过程(例如,干扰医疗程序,干扰司法)。

interference with = 干扰(某人/某事) (用于指明被干涉的人、事物或过程(例如,干扰医疗程序,干扰司法)。)
- The doctor was accused of interference with proper medical procedures.该医生被指控干预适当的医疗程序。
- The lawyer argued that there was undue interference with the legal process.律师辩称,存在不当干预法律程序的行为。
- Any interference with the equipment could cause a malfunction.任何干扰设备的行为都可能导致故障。
- The government warned against foreign interference with their internal affairs.政府警告不要外国干预其内部事务。
- She faced accusations of interference with witnesses during the trial.她被指控在审判期间干预证人。
- There should be no interference with the patient's right to choose.不应干预患者的选择权。
- He was charged with interference with a police investigation.他被指控妨碍警方的调查。
- The new regulations aim to prevent interference with fair competition.新规定旨在防止干扰公平竞争。
- We must avoid any interference with the natural ecosystem.我们必须避免任何干扰自然生态系统的行为。
- Concerns were raised about potential interference with election results.有人对可能干预选举结果表示担忧。
